What you'll learn

Course contents
  • Minimise waste and recycle or dispose of waste in line with business environmental and sustainability policies
  • Comply with risk assessments, safe systems of work, company safety policy and procedures at all times
  • Sample product either on production site or on customers site using the appropriate equipment for the product. For example, asphalt testing would include tests such as: organoleptic analysis, binder content, grading analysis, temperature, bulk density, % refusal density, insitu density and texture depth “ when thinking of asphalt testing “ assessing whether the material correct and whether it been laid correctly
  • Plan and perform tasks following Standard Operating Procedures (SOP) and safe systems of work
  • Produce reliable and accurate reports
  • Follow industry guidance when completing sampling tasks and and record progress against them
  • Diagnose faults with sampling and testing equipment and take appropriate actions
  • Identify deficiencies in both product and the placement of the product. (e.g. concrete being poured into foundations which are holding rain water)
  • Analyse, interpret and evaluate data and identify results requiring further investigation (non-conformance) seeking advice from colleagues as appropriate
  • Deal with issues calmly and diffuse difficult situations
  • Provide courteous and attentive customer service in every aspect of the role, this includes preparing clear written reports and listening and speaking to customers politely, explaining issues factually and clearly
  • Communicate information, including the use of information management systems, either digital or paper based
  • Communicate with people at all levels effectively ensuring accurate information is passed clearly and promptly
  • Work within the company rules and regulations
  • Use IT software and systems in line with company policy and procedures. This will include using test data entry, analysis and reporting systems
